Three friends namely F, G and H are rowing their boats in a same river. Speeds of F and G in still water are 6 km/h more and 4 km/h more, respectively than speed of H in still water. Ratio of speed of G in downstream to speed of H in downstream is 4 : 3. Find the distance covered by H in 5 hours while going against the stream. Which of the following option alone is not sufficient to find the answer? I The river is flowing at a rate of 2 km/h. II Difference between upstream speed of F and H is 6 km/h. III Ratio of upstream speed G and H is 3 : 2, respectively. IV H covers 240 km downstream in 20 hours.
